South Littleton: A Tranquil Village Retreat in Worcestershire

Nestled in the picturesque Worcestershire countryside, South Littleton is a charming village that boasts a rich history and a strong sense of community. With its quaint cottages and scenic landscapes, the village offers a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life. Historically, South Littleton has been an agricultural settlement, but it has gradually evolved into a desirable location for those seeking a slower pace, blending rural charm with modern conveniences.

The village is characterized by its well-preserved architecture and friendly atmosphere, making it a welcoming place for newcomers. The low crime rate, standing at an impressive 99% below the national average, adds to the appeal of this tranquil area. Residents enjoy the benefits of a close-knit community, where local events and gatherings are commonplace, fostering connections among families and individuals alike.
